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Scratch Course Catalog
Coursera Project Network
Skills you'll gain: Facebook, Marketing Design, Marketing Materials, Promotional Materials, Social Media Content, Social Media, Content Creation, Advertising, Branding, Social Media Marketing, Photo Editing, Marketing, Graphic Design, Digital Advertising
- Status: NewStatus: Preview
Heriot-Watt University
Skills you'll gain: Object Oriented Programming (OOP), Java, Java Programming, Computer Programming, Programming Principles, Software Development, Algorithms, Computational Logic
- Status: NewStatus: Free Trial
Vanderbilt University
Skills you'll gain: Generative AI Agents, Java, JUnit, Generative AI, LLM Application, OpenAI, Prompt Engineering, Large Language Modeling
Coursera Project Network
Skills you'll gain: Photo Editing, Facebook, Digital Advertising, Graphic Design, Marketing Design, Social Media Content, Social Media Marketing, Advertising, Social Media, Dashboard, Marketing, User Accounts, Business
- Status: Free Trial
Scrimba
Skills you'll gain: Typography, Responsive Web Design, Cascading Style Sheets (CSS), HTML and CSS, Web Design, Front-End Web Development, UI Components, Web Development
- Status: NewStatus: Free Trial
Skills you'll gain: Business Writing, Concision, Writing, Persuasive Communication, Technical Writing, Business Communication, Grammar, Target Audience, Writing and Editing, Report Writing, Editing, Technical Communication, Proofreading, Communication, Prompt Engineering, Productivity
- Status: NewStatus: Free Trial
Skills you'll gain: Restful API, Application Deployment, Generative AI, Application Programming Interface (API), Java, Test Tools, Development Environment, Image Analysis, Software Development, Computer Vision
- Status: Free
DeepLearning.AI
Skills you'll gain: Generative AI Agents, Agentic systems, LLM Application, Generative AI, Large Language Modeling, Artificial Intelligence, Tool Calling, Prompt Engineering, Software Design Patterns
Coursera Project Network
Skills you'll gain: Prompt Engineering, Generative AI, Development Environment, Computational Thinking, Program Development, Software Development, Python Programming, Game Design, Debugging
- Status: Free Trial
Duke University
Skills you'll gain: Large Language Modeling, Generative AI, Rust (Programming Language), MLOps (Machine Learning Operations), AWS SageMaker, PyTorch (Machine Learning Library), CI/CD, Prompt Engineering, Applied Machine Learning, Application Deployment, Natural Language Processing, DevOps, Amazon Web Services, Machine Learning, Deep Learning
- Status: Free Trial
Board Infinity
Skills you'll gain: Cascading Style Sheets (CSS), Web Design and Development, User Interface and User Experience (UI/UX) Design, Web Content Accessibility Guidelines
Skills you'll gain: Embedded Software, Embedded Systems, C++ (Programming Language), Object Oriented Programming (OOP), System Programming, C (Programming Language), Development Environment, Verification And Validation, Software Testing, Peripheral Devices, Debugging
Scratch learners also search
In summary, here are 10 of our most popular scratch courses
- Advertise and grow your business on Facebook with Canva: Coursera Project Network
- Learn Java Programming: Heriot-Watt University
- AI Agents in Java with Generative AI: Vanderbilt University
- Digital Business Marketing with Easil: Coursera Project Network
- Learn Tailwind CSS: Scrimba
- Business Writing & Technical Writing Immersion: Starweaver
- Generative AI for Java and Spring Development: SkillUp
- AI Agentic Design Patterns with AutoGen: DeepLearning.AI
- Gen AI for Software Development: Code Generation for Python: Coursera Project Network
- Rust for Large Language Model Operations (LLMOps): Duke University